Peddapalli Anganwadi Teacher Recruitment 2026 Grassroots government jobs rarely make headlines, but for thousands of women in Telangana’s Peddapalli district, the Anganwadi Teacher recruitment cycle is one of the most awaited employment events of the year. It offers a rare combination: a respected role working directly with children and mothers in your own locality, a government-linked honorarium, and — unlike most competitive exams — an application process that doesn’t demand months of preparation for a written test.

The Women Development & Child Welfare (WDCW) Department, Peddapalli district, has opened applications for 64 Anganwadi Teacher (AWT) posts spread across three ICDS projects — Manthani, Peddapalli, and Ramagundam (Urban). The notification, numbered B/114/2026-I, II, and III and dated June 18, 2026, is open only to women candidates, and the online application window closes on July 6, 2026, at 5:00 PM.

Why This Recruitment Matters for Peddapalli District

Peddapalli Anganwadi Teacher Recruitment 2026 Centres are the backbone of India’s Integrated Child Development Services (ICDS) scheme, delivering pre-school education, nutrition support, and health referrals to children under six and to pregnant and lactating mothers. An Anganwadi Teacher is the frontline worker who runs this centre daily. For a district like Peddapalli — carved out of the erstwhile Karimnagar region and home to a mix of urban, semi-urban, and rural mandals — filling these 64 vacant AWT posts directly affects early childhood care coverage across dozens of villages and colonies.

For applicants, the appeal is straightforward: the job is usually based close to home, the honorarium is paid monthly by the state government, and there’s a defined, transparent selection process built around local residency and marks-based merit rather than a written competitive exam.

Project-Wise Vacancy Distribution

The 64 posts for Peddapalli Anganwadi Teacher Recruitment 2026 are not clustered in one place — they’re distributed across three separate ICDS project areas, each covering a defined set of mandals and Anganwadi Centres (AWCs). Applicants should apply only for the project area covering their eligible AWC, since local-residency preference typically plays a role in ICDS-linked recruitment.

ICDS ProjectAWT VacanciesShare of Total
Manthani4367%
Peddapalli1727%
Ramagundam (Urban)46%
Total64100%

Manthani alone accounts for two out of every three vacancies in this drive, making it the project area with the widest spread of opportunity this year, while Ramagundam (U) has the tightest competition with just four seats.


Category-Wise Reservation Breakdown

Peddapalli Anganwadi Teacher Recruitment 2026 in Telangana follows the state’s standard horizontal and vertical reservation matrix, covering SC, ST, BC sub-categories, EWS, Ex-servicemen dependents, and persons with disabilities, alongside Open Category (OC) seats. Here’s how the 64 posts break down by reserved category across all three projects combined.

CategoryVacancies
OC (Open Category)17
SC Group-I2
SC Group-II6
SC Group-III2
ST4
BC-A6
BC-B4
BC-C2
BC-D4
BC-E3
EWS6
Ex-Servicemen (OC)3
VH (Visually Handicapped)2
HH (Hearing Handicapped)1
Total64

A quick read of this table shows OC seats form the largest single block (17), followed closely by SC Group-II and EWS candidates at 6 seats each. Two seats are specifically reserved for visually handicapped women and one for a hearing-handicapped candidate — a reminder that ICDS recruitment in Telangana builds in disability reservation even at the grassroots level, something candidates with disabilities should not overlook.

Selection Process — Peddapalli Anganwadi Teacher Recruitment 2026

Unlike many government recruitment drives, Anganwadi Teacher selection does not typically involve a written examination. Instead, selection in Telangana is generally based on a merit list prepared from marks obtained in the qualifying educational examination, combined with applicable reservation and local-residency rules. The process usually unfolds like this:

  1. Application scrutiny — the WCD office verifies eligibility, category certificates, and residency proof.
  2. Merit list preparation — candidates are ranked by their qualifying exam marks (often Intermediate marks), converted to a common scale if needed.
  3. Provisional selection list publication — displayed at the local Mandal/Project office and often uploaded to the district WCD page.
  4. Objection window — a short period during which candidates can raise grievances about the provisional list.
  5. Final selection and appointment orders.

Because there is no interview or written test in most cycles, accuracy in your application — correct marks entered, correct category proof uploaded — matters enormously. A single data-entry error can knock a candidate out of contention long before any human reviews the file.

A Realistic Look at Your Chances

With 64 posts open across 64 individual Anganwadi Centres — each seat tied to a specific AWC and reserved category — this isn’t a “one big merit list, thousands compete” scenario. Each seat effectively runs its own mini-competition among eligible women residing in that AWC’s catchment area under that specific reserved category. That structure means your real competition is usually a much smaller, local pool rather than the entire district. If you meet the residency and category requirements for a specific AWC listed in the notification, your odds are meaningfully better than a state-level exam would suggest — but accuracy and timely submission still decide outcomes.
